The name Zaq is a modern, creative variation of the name Zach or Zack, which are typically short forms of the name Zachary. Zachary is of Hebrew origin, meaning "remembered by God" or "God has remembered". The name Zaq is often used to give a unique and contemporary twist to the traditional name Zach or Zack. Its origin is based in American culture, where parents increasingly choose uncommon variations of more popular names to make them stand out. The name Zaq may also be seen as a trendy and edgy alternative for those who want a name that is both familiar and distinctive.

The variations of the first name "zaq" include "Zach," "Zack," and "Zachary." These variations are common alternatives that are often used interchangeably depending on personal preference or cultural influences. Each variation carries a similar sound and spelling, but may have different origins or meanings. "Zach" is a popular shortened form of "Zachary," while "Zack" is a common alternative spelling.
